Output 180c1ce90826b8b27fcbdf56ecf0f0dc8cc924e5ba8cae8dcd762c42b2bc0b03:117

value
34582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bfc75539133817fe924a6c11a15e8c8d539768a OP_EQUAL
address
3Fuo6PTs7VAkKwbB7Rmp4GYJP8P9cX7KXY
transaction
180c1ce90826b8b27fcbdf56ecf0f0dc8cc924e5ba8cae8dcd762c42b2bc0b03
spent
true